Sections & blocks explained
Understand how Squarespace pages are built from sections and blocks, and learn how to add, move, and delete them.
Every Squarespace page is built from two main components: sections and blocks. Once you understand these two things, editing any page becomes much simpler.
Quick summary
A section is a full-width horizontal row on your page. Inside each section, you add blocks — the individual pieces of content like text, images, buttons, and forms. You can add, move, duplicate, and delete both sections and blocks.
What is a section?
A section is a horizontal strip that spans the full width of your page. Most pages are made up of several sections stacked on top of each other — for example:
- A hero section (large image with headline text)
- A services section (text and icons)
- A testimonials section
- A contact section
Sections give your page its structure. You can change the background color or image of each section independently.
What is a block?
A block is a single piece of content inside a section. Squarespace has many block types:
| Block type | What it does |
|---|---|
| Text | Paragraphs, headings, formatted content |
| Image | A single photo |
| Video | An embedded video |
| Button | A clickable button |
| Gallery | A grid or slideshow of images |
| Form | A contact or signup form |
| Map | An embedded Google Map |
| Social links | Links to your social media profiles |
| Code | Custom HTML or script (leave to Chykalophia) |
You can add multiple blocks inside one section. The layout of those blocks is controlled by the section's column grid.
Adding a section
Open the page editor (see How to edit a page).
Hover between two existing sections. A horizontal line with a + icon will appear.
Click the + icon. A panel opens showing section layout options — choose a layout or start from blank.
The new section is added. You can now add blocks inside it.
Adding a block
Inside any section, click the + icon that appears when you hover over an empty area.
Choose a block type from the panel that appears.
The block is added to that section. Click it to start editing.
Moving and rearranging
- Move a block — click and hold the block, then drag it to a new position within the same section (or sometimes to a different section).
- Move a section — hover over the section edge and click the section options icon. Use the arrows or drag handle to move the section up or down the page.
Deleting a section or block
Click on the section or block to select it.
Click the delete icon (usually a trash can) in the options that appear.
Confirm the deletion when prompted.
Deleting a section deletes all its blocks too
When you delete a section, all the blocks inside it are deleted as well. Make sure you don't need any of the content before deleting.
